This document describes a smart dustbin system that uses IoT technologies like GPS tracking and ultrasonic sensors. The system aims to more efficiently manage waste collection. It includes smart dustbins connected to a real-time monitoring system. Ultrasonic sensors in the dustbins measure waste levels and send this data via NodeMCU microcontrollers and GPS modules to the cloud for analysis. When a bin reaches capacity, an alert is sent to waste collectors with the bin's location from the GPS data. This allows for automated, on-demand waste collection to keep areas cleaner. The system is intended to reduce costs, waste, and human effort compared to traditional waste management methods.
